Description

A fork lift created for my prototyping unit in my HND CADD course and NL College.

Purpose
The purpose of the fork lift is to have a model and drawings to create a functioning prototype from that is capable of lifting a create off of a shelf 350mm high.
Solution
The mast on the fork lift is a two stage system meaning it has more than enough reach for the needs
Audience
The fork lift would be best for companies in the construction industry as it is designed for an environment with uneven terrain.
